About
Turn any two devices into a wireless remote camera system — no internet, no router, no account needed. Just connect and shoot. Remote Shutter uses peer-to-peer technology to link two devices directly. One becomes the camera, the other becomes your remote control with a live monitor. Perfect for group photos, selfies, tripod shots, creative angles, and hands-free photography. NEW — FULL MAC SUPPORT - Use your Mac as the camera: built-in, USB and pro webcams, even your iPhone via Continuity Camera - Switch between every camera connected to your Mac, live from your iPhone - Or flip it: use your Mac's big screen as a director's monitor for your iPhone camera FEATURES - Control your camera from your Apple Watch — trigger the shutter from your wrist - Selfies and group shots on the sharp rear camera — frame yourself from the remote's live preview - Wireless remote shutter from up to 50 feet away - Live camera preview on your remote device - Switch cameras remotely — front/back on iPhone, any connected camera on Mac - Camera flash control - Adjustable photo timer - Record video remotely - Works with iPhone, iPad, and Mac - No internet or Wi-Fi network required — direct device-to-device connection (just keep Wi-Fi and Bluetooth turned on) HOW TO USE 1. Open Remote Shutter on two devices 2. Devices connect automatically via peer-to-peer 3. Choose which device is the camera and which is the remote 4. Start shooting from anywhere in the room! Whether you're shooting products with a pro camera on your Mac, directing from the big screen, or setting up a family photo, Remote Shutter gives you full wireless control of your camera from another device.
